Team,

Friday's drill fails over the Pagefront REST API to the Norwick region. Focus area: cursor-based pagination. Verify cursors issued pre-failover remain valid post-failover, and that page sizes cap at documented limits. Any opaque cursor that decodes to internal offsets is a finding. Security review sign-off required before we restore primary. The drill vault containing the failover credentials is sealed; to open it during the exercise, supply the recovery passphrase noted directly below.

— Dela

strongbox words: eliius-pelath-sorius-oliys-noviel

14:22 — Offline sync regression confirmed (Terrapath field-survey app)

At 14:22 the on-call engineer reproduced the data-loss path: surveys saved while offline were marked synced once connectivity returned, even when the upload was rejected. The queue flush skipped the server acknowledgement check introduced in the previous sprint. Release manager note: the fix must ship before the coastal survey season. The offending build is identified by the token recorded below.

session token of kawif-fawig = htk31_f3f599be2b1a34affb1efa8d0feccf8

**Postmortem timeline — Wrenfall tile prefetcher**

14:02 — Prefetcher began requesting tiles for zoom levels users never viewed, tripling cache churn. Root cause: a viewport-prediction change shipped without the throttle flag. Contractors should note the flag defaults off in staging but on in prod, which hid the regression. Rollback completed at 14:41; cache hit rates recovered within the hour. The offending build is recorded below.

session token of tajef-bageg = htk21_5d90d574934f3ccae6437

### Runbook: Recovering a Suspended Webhook Account

If your Parcelwise plugin account is suspended, your parcel-tracking webhook stops receiving delivery events immediately, and queued events expire after 48 hours. Begin recovery promptly. Open the plugin portal, choose account recovery, and confirm your registered endpoint. When prompted for the recovery challenge, supply the passphrase issued at plugin registration, reproduced below for reference.

unlock words, kagef-taduf: fenir-quenix-norwyn-sorvan-gormir-gorir-fraok